2.1 Understanding dTelecom and the dRTC Network
dTelecom is a decentralized real-time communications (dRTC) network built primarily on the Solana blockchain, designed to provide seamless voice, video, chat, and AI-powered communication experiences without relying on centralized servers or traditional telecom providers. The project operates as a Decentralized Physical Infrastructure Network (DePIN), where community members run nodes, provide bandwidth, and earn cryptocurrency rewards for their contributions.
Core Technology Architecture:
- Blockchain Foundation: Built on Solana for high-speed, low-latency transactions, with smart contracts deployed on peaq (DePIN-focused Layer-1)
- Node Network: Community-operated relay nodes enable decentralized distribution of live audio and video streams
- WebRTC Integration: Industry-standard real-time communication protocols enhanced with blockchain incentives
- AI-Powered Features: Real-time translation, automated moderation, noise cancellation, and voice agents
- Multi-Chain Support: Cross-chain infrastructure planning for Ethereum, BNB Chain, and other major networks
According to the official whitepaper, dTelecom addresses critical failures in centralized telecommunications:
- Censorship Resistance: No single entity can shut down or control the network
- Data Sovereignty: Users own their communication data, not corporations
- Cost Efficiency: Peer-to-peer architecture eliminates middleman costs
- Privacy Protection: End-to-end encryption with no centralized data harvesting
- Economic Incentives: Contributors earn $DTEL tokens for providing network resources

3.3 Points-to-Token Conversion Mechanism

The current Points Program serves as the pre-TGE distribution mechanism, with accumulated points converting directly to $DTEL tokens upon launch:
How Points Convert to Tokens:
- Snapshot Date: Final snapshot occurs before TGE
- Conversion Rate: Points-to-$DTEL ratio determined by total points accumulated across all users
- Pro-Rata Distribution: Your share = (Your Points ÷ Total Network Points) × Community Allocation Pool
- Multiplier Bonuses: Early participants and high-streak users may receive bonus multipliers
- Anti-Sybil Measures: Duplicate accounts and bot activity disqualified from distribution
Example Calculation (Hypothetical):
- Total Community Allocation: 50 million $DTEL tokens
- Total Network Points: 500 million points
- Your Accumulated Points: 50,000 points
- Your Allocation: (50,000 ÷ 500,000,000) × 50,000,000 = 5,000 $DTEL tokens

6.4 Risk Factors and Considerations
Technical Risks:
- Network Performance: Real-time communication requires low latency; infrastructure challenges could impact user experience
- Scalability: Can the network handle millions of concurrent calls without degradation?
- Security Vulnerabilities: Decentralized systems present unique attack vectors
- Interoperability: Cross-chain bridges and multi-blockchain support add complexity
Market Risks:
- Bear Market Impact: Crypto winter could suppress token price regardless of fundamentals
- Competition: Traditional platforms (Zoom, Google Meet) could co-opt decentralization features
- Regulatory Uncertainty: Telecommunications regulations vary globally and could impact operations
- User Adoption: Mainstream users may prioritize convenience over privacy/censorship-resistance
Tokenomics Risks:
- Vesting Unlocks: Large token releases could create sell pressure
- Airdrop Dumping: If majority of airdrop recipients sell immediately, price could crash
- Insufficient Utility: Token may not be required for core network functions
- Inflationary Pressure: High emission rates could outpace demand growth
Project-Specific Risks:
- Team Execution: Can the team deliver on ambitious roadmap?
- Partnership Delivery: Will announced partnerships translate to actual integration?
- Community Retention: Can the project keep users engaged post-airdrop?
- Funding Sustainability: Is the project adequately capitalized for multi-year development?
